Procedure to access the Filing application

To access the CBSO Filing application, a modern external interface is used, CSAM, the portal for online government services.

Various types of digital keys can be used to log in.

Logging in with an electronic ID card via CSAM
eID

You can use your identity card and an eID card reader to log in. This is the standard procedure to access various Belgian government online services and guarantees the highest level of protection.

To log in with your eID, you will need the following:

 

Your eID card. Always insert your eID in the card reader before going to the online portal.

 

A four-digit PIN.

 

Appropriate software to use your eID. This can be downloaded for free at Download eID software (belgium.be).

eid reader A card reader::
  • Built-in card reader: Some computers and keyboards have a built-in card reader.
  • Stand-alone card reader: You can easily connect a stand-alone card reader to your PC with a cable.

Logging in with itsme, your digital ID via CSAM
itsme

You can use your digital ID to log in securely with your smartphone.

In order to use this option, you must first register with itsme.

Logging in with an EU-recognised login tool with eIDAS via CSAM
itsme

Citizens of other European Union countries can use eIDAS to log into Belgian government online services with their national means of identification and authentication.

A list of countries for which a national identifier can be used to log in can be consulted by choosing “Log in with an EU-recognised login method” when logging in to an online service.

Logging in by other means via IDAAS

For foreign nationals and third-party declarants who cannot use an eID, itsme or eIDAS to log in, access by means of an electronic certificate by name has been provided through IDAAS (Identity As A service) since 23/01/2024.

Accounting firms can also log in through this new access using a commercial certificate.

Logging in via CSAM with your commercial certificate will no longer be possible from 01/02/2024.
